What are the responsibilities and job description for the Lead Java Developer position at GSS Infotech?
Job Details
Lead the design, development, and deployment of Java-based applications using Spring and Spring Boot.
Utilize Kubernetes (K8S) for container orchestration and management.
Implement monitoring and performance optimization using AppDynamics (ApPD) and Datadog.
Ensure applications are scalable and reliable to meet the demands of large-scale customer operations.
Collaborate with cross-functional teams to deliver high-quality software solutions.
Provide technical leadership and mentorship to junior developers.
Support and enhance existing applications, ensuring they meet business requirements.
Integrate and maintain Interactive Voice Response (IVR) systems as needed.
Requirements:
Proven experience as a Lead Java Developer or similar role.
Strong expertise in Java, Spring, and Spring Boot.
Experience with Kubernetes (K8S) for container orchestration.
Proficiency in using AppDynamics (ApPD) and Datadog for monitoring and performance optimization.
Demonstrated ability to develop and deploy applications at scale.
Strong problem-solving skills and ability to work in a fast-paced environment.
Excellent communication and teamwork skills.
Experience with customer operations and support applications.
IVR experience is a plus.